{"id":"https://openalex.org/W4406022580","doi":"https://doi.org/10.1145/3704522.3704535","title":"Assessing ChatGPT\u2019s Code Generation Capabilities with Short vs Long Context Programming Problems","display_name":"Assessing ChatGPT\u2019s Code Generation Capabilities with Short vs Long Context Programming Problems","publication_year":2024,"publication_date":"2024-12-19","ids":{"openalex":"https://openalex.org/W4406022580","doi":"https://doi.org/10.1145/3704522.3704535"},"language":"en","primary_location":{"id":"doi:10.1145/3704522.3704535","is_oa":true,"landing_page_url":"https://doi.org/10.1145/3704522.3704535","pdf_url":null,"source":null,"license":"cc-by","license_id":"https://openalex.org/licenses/cc-by","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 11th International Conference on Networking, Systems, and Security","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":true,"oa_status":"gold","oa_url":"https://doi.org/10.1145/3704522.3704535","any_repository_has_fulltext":true},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5099380962","display_name":"Uddip Acharjee Shuvo","orcid":null},"institutions":[{"id":"https://openalex.org/I205746353","display_name":"University of Dhaka","ror":"https://ror.org/05wv2vq37","country_code":"BD","type":"education","lineage":["https://openalex.org/I205746353"]}],"countries":["BD"],"is_corresponding":true,"raw_author_name":"Uddip Acharjee Shuvo","raw_affiliation_strings":["Institute of Information Technology, University of Dhaka, Bangladesh, Dhaka, Bangladesh"],"affiliations":[{"raw_affiliation_string":"Institute of Information Technology, University of Dhaka, Bangladesh, Dhaka, Bangladesh","institution_ids":["https://openalex.org/I205746353"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5099380961","display_name":"Sajib Acharjee Dip","orcid":"https://orcid.org/0009-0007-0959-2638"},"institutions":[{"id":"https://openalex.org/I859038795","display_name":"Virginia Tech","ror":"https://ror.org/02smfhw86","country_code":"US","type":"education","lineage":["https://openalex.org/I859038795"]}],"countries":["US"],"is_corresponding":false,"raw_author_name":"Sajib Acharjee Dip","raw_affiliation_strings":["Computer Science and Engineering, Virginia Tech, USA, Blacksburg, USA"],"affiliations":[{"raw_affiliation_string":"Computer Science and Engineering, Virginia Tech, USA, Blacksburg, USA","institution_ids":["https://openalex.org/I859038795"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5115753861","display_name":"Nirvar Roy Vaskar","orcid":null},"institutions":[{"id":"https://openalex.org/I103434671","display_name":"American International University-Bangladesh","ror":"https://ror.org/02j8ga255","country_code":"BD","type":"education","lineage":["https://openalex.org/I103434671"]}],"countries":["BD"],"is_corresponding":false,"raw_author_name":"Nirvar Roy Vaskar","raw_affiliation_strings":["American International University - Bangladesh, Dhaka, Bangladesh"],"affiliations":[{"raw_affiliation_string":"American International University - Bangladesh, Dhaka, Bangladesh","institution_ids":["https://openalex.org/I103434671"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5029221184","display_name":"A. B. M. Alim Al Islam","orcid":"https://orcid.org/0000-0001-8159-6114"},"institutions":[{"id":"https://openalex.org/I183697816","display_name":"Bangladesh University of Engineering and Technology","ror":"https://ror.org/05a1qpv97","country_code":"BD","type":"education","lineage":["https://openalex.org/I183697816"]}],"countries":["BD"],"is_corresponding":false,"raw_author_name":"A. B. M. Alim Al Islam","raw_affiliation_strings":["Computer Science and Engineering, Bangladesh University of Engineering and Technology, Dhaka, Bangladesh"],"affiliations":[{"raw_affiliation_string":"Computer Science and Engineering, Bangladesh University of Engineering and Technology, Dhaka, Bangladesh","institution_ids":["https://openalex.org/I183697816"]}]}],"institutions":[],"countries_distinct_count":2,"institutions_distinct_count":4,"corresponding_author_ids":["https://openalex.org/A5099380962"],"corresponding_institution_ids":["https://openalex.org/I205746353"],"apc_list":null,"apc_paid":null,"fwci":0.6287,"has_fulltext":false,"cited_by_count":5,"citation_normalized_percentile":{"value":0.72590206,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":97,"max":99},"biblio":{"volume":null,"issue":null,"first_page":"32","last_page":"40"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T11636","display_name":"Artificial Intelligence in Healthcare and Education","score":0.9926999807357788,"subfield":{"id":"https://openalex.org/subfields/2718","display_name":"Health Informatics"},"field":{"id":"https://openalex.org/fields/27","display_name":"Medicine"},"domain":{"id":"https://openalex.org/domains/4","display_name":"Health Sciences"}},"topics":[{"id":"https://openalex.org/T11636","display_name":"Artificial Intelligence in Healthcare and Education","score":0.9926999807357788,"subfield":{"id":"https://openalex.org/subfields/2718","display_name":"Health Informatics"},"field":{"id":"https://openalex.org/fields/27","display_name":"Medicine"},"domain":{"id":"https://openalex.org/domains/4","display_name":"Health Sciences"}},{"id":"https://openalex.org/T10028","display_name":"Topic Modeling","score":0.9876000285148621,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T12128","display_name":"AI in Service Interactions","score":0.9789000153541565,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.748389482498169},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.6884340047836304},{"id":"https://openalex.org/keywords/context","display_name":"Context (archaeology)","score":0.5737271308898926},{"id":"https://openalex.org/keywords/code","display_name":"Code (set theory)","score":0.5542927980422974},{"id":"https://openalex.org/keywords/code-generation","display_name":"Code generation","score":0.5438204407691956},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.3777502477169037},{"id":"https://openalex.org/keywords/operating-system","display_name":"Operating system","score":0.20581156015396118},{"id":"https://openalex.org/keywords/history","display_name":"History","score":0.06875148415565491}],"concepts":[{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.748389482498169},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.6884340047836304},{"id":"https://openalex.org/C2779343474","wikidata":"https://www.wikidata.org/wiki/Q3109175","display_name":"Context (archaeology)","level":2,"score":0.5737271308898926},{"id":"https://openalex.org/C2776760102","wikidata":"https://www.wikidata.org/wiki/Q5139990","display_name":"Code (set theory)","level":3,"score":0.5542927980422974},{"id":"https://openalex.org/C133162039","wikidata":"https://www.wikidata.org/wiki/Q1061077","display_name":"Code generation","level":3,"score":0.5438204407691956},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.3777502477169037},{"id":"https://openalex.org/C111919701","wikidata":"https://www.wikidata.org/wiki/Q9135","display_name":"Operating system","level":1,"score":0.20581156015396118},{"id":"https://openalex.org/C95457728","wikidata":"https://www.wikidata.org/wiki/Q309","display_name":"History","level":0,"score":0.06875148415565491},{"id":"https://openalex.org/C177264268","wikidata":"https://www.wikidata.org/wiki/Q1514741","display_name":"Set (abstract data type)","level":2,"score":0.0},{"id":"https://openalex.org/C26517878","wikidata":"https://www.wikidata.org/wiki/Q228039","display_name":"Key (lock)","level":2,"score":0.0},{"id":"https://openalex.org/C166957645","wikidata":"https://www.wikidata.org/wiki/Q23498","display_name":"Archaeology","level":1,"score":0.0}],"mesh":[],"locations_count":2,"locations":[{"id":"doi:10.1145/3704522.3704535","is_oa":true,"landing_page_url":"https://doi.org/10.1145/3704522.3704535","pdf_url":null,"source":null,"license":"cc-by","license_id":"https://openalex.org/licenses/cc-by","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 11th International Conference on Networking, Systems, and Security","raw_type":"proceedings-article"},{"id":"pmh:oai:vtechworks.lib.vt.edu:10919/124515","is_oa":true,"landing_page_url":"https://hdl.handle.net/10919/124515","pdf_url":"https://vtechworks.lib.vt.edu/bitstreams/0ee90e7e-8ea9-4a0c-b215-1d8b73649be2/download","source":{"id":"https://openalex.org/S4306400248","display_name":"VTechWorks (Virginia Tech)","issn_l":null,"issn":null,"is_oa":false,"is_in_doaj":false,"is_core":false,"host_organization":"https://openalex.org/I859038795","host_organization_name":"Virginia Tech","host_organization_lineage":["https://openalex.org/I859038795"],"host_organization_lineage_names":[],"type":"repository"},"license":"cc-by","license_id":"https://openalex.org/licenses/cc-by","version":"submittedVersion","is_accepted":false,"is_published":false,"raw_source_name":null,"raw_type":"Text"}],"best_oa_location":{"id":"doi:10.1145/3704522.3704535","is_oa":true,"landing_page_url":"https://doi.org/10.1145/3704522.3704535","pdf_url":null,"source":null,"license":"cc-by","license_id":"https://openalex.org/licenses/cc-by","version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 11th International Conference on Networking, Systems, and Security","raw_type":"proceedings-article"},"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":20,"referenced_works":["https://openalex.org/W2949215742","https://openalex.org/W2963935794","https://openalex.org/W3086449553","https://openalex.org/W3108032709","https://openalex.org/W4321013654","https://openalex.org/W4390674924","https://openalex.org/W4390723974","https://openalex.org/W4391986589","https://openalex.org/W4392414327","https://openalex.org/W4398187660","https://openalex.org/W4398762751","https://openalex.org/W4399577572","https://openalex.org/W4399586813","https://openalex.org/W4400582696","https://openalex.org/W4401543590","https://openalex.org/W4402410226","https://openalex.org/W4402671958","https://openalex.org/W4402835670","https://openalex.org/W4403296573","https://openalex.org/W4404187834"],"related_works":["https://openalex.org/W4231937131","https://openalex.org/W323219885","https://openalex.org/W2063928587","https://openalex.org/W1487966966","https://openalex.org/W1589342014","https://openalex.org/W1480341462","https://openalex.org/W2163672025","https://openalex.org/W2048831961","https://openalex.org/W1606349578","https://openalex.org/W4399567378"],"abstract_inverted_index":{"This":[0,151],"study":[1],"assesses":[2],"the":[3,50,90,156],"code":[4,69,131,163],"generation":[5,164],"capabilities":[6],"of":[7,54,92,160],"ChatGPT":[8],"using":[9,85],"competitive":[10],"programming":[11,120],"problems":[12,33,40,73,84,143],"from":[13,34,41],"platforms":[14],"such":[15],"as":[16],"LeetCode,":[17],"HackerRank,":[18],"and":[19,61,126,133,144,158,165],"UVa":[20],"Online":[21],"Judge.":[22],"In":[23],"a":[24,107],"novel":[25],"approach,":[26],"we":[27,88],"contrast":[28],"ChatGPT\u2019s":[29,139],"performance":[30,111,140],"on":[31,141],"concise":[32],"LeetCode":[35,72,101],"against":[36],"more":[37],"complex,":[38],"narrative-driven":[39],"Codeforces.":[42],"Our":[43,114],"results":[44],"reveal":[45],"significant":[46],"challenges":[47],"in":[48,58,64,109,162,171],"addressing":[49],"intricate":[51],"narrative":[52],"structures":[53],"Codeforces,":[55],"with":[56],"difficulties":[57],"problem":[59],"recognition":[60],"strategic":[62],"planning":[63],"extended":[65],"contexts.":[66],"While":[67],"initial":[68],"accuracy":[70,102],"for":[71,81,168],"stands":[74],"at":[75,96],"72%,":[76],"it":[77],"drops":[78],"to":[79,103,112],"31%":[80],"complex":[82],"Codeforces":[83,110],"Python.":[86],"Additionally,":[87],"explore":[89],"impact":[91],"targeted":[93],"instructions":[94],"aimed":[95],"enhancing":[97],"performance,":[98],"which":[99],"increased":[100],"73.53%":[104],"but":[105],"saw":[106],"decrease":[108],"29%.":[113],"analysis":[115],"further":[116],"extends":[117],"across":[118],"multiple":[119],"languages,":[121],"examining":[122],"if":[123],"iterative":[124],"prompting":[125],"specific":[127],"feedback":[128],"can":[129],"enhance":[130],"precision":[132],"efficiency.":[134],"We":[135],"also":[136],"delve":[137],"into":[138,155],"challenging":[142],"those":[145],"released":[146],"post":[147],"its":[148],"training":[149],"period.":[150],"research":[152],"provides":[153],"insights":[154],"strengths":[157],"weaknesses":[159],"AI":[161],"lays":[166],"groundwork":[167],"future":[169],"developments":[170],"AI-driven":[172],"coding":[173],"tools.":[174]},"counts_by_year":[{"year":2026,"cited_by_count":1},{"year":2025,"cited_by_count":4}],"updated_date":"2025-12-27T23:08:20.325037","created_date":"2025-10-10T00:00:00"}
